The central artwork features a detailed, realistic depiction of a bird perched on a curved tree branch. The bird has a distinctive red patch on its forehead, a white throat with a red band, and greyish-brown plumage. It is positioned diagonally across the scene, facing toward the right side. Behind the bird, a slender branch with small, sage-green, heart-shaped leaves stretches upward into the upper-left quadrant of the frame.
The entire composition is enclosed within a cream-coloured background that has a slightly textured, antique parchment appearance. This central panel is surrounded by a decorative border featuring repeating, stylized dark red floral or leaf patterns on a light background. The style resembles a classical botanical or ornithological print, conveying a sense of vintage nature study and understated elegance.
The colour palette is muted and earthy, relying on soft greens, browns, and cream tones, which are contrasted by the vibrant red accents on the bird and the floral border. The lighting appears even and flat, typical of an illustrative nature study, creating a calm and timeless mood. The artistic technique suggests a combination of gouache or watercolour on textured paper, giving the image a soft, artistic quality that evokes the feel of a traditional illustration.
